*This Is No Place to Die* opens with the discovery of a corpse—that of a dog—by a young boy, the narrator. This psychological collision is conveyed through the very structure of the play, which unfolds to reveal a family entangled in its own drama, pain, shame, and silence. A family that believed it had to disguise the death of its son with a distant journey, turning it into a secret. A family living in the shadow of a corpse, whose relationships are entangled in the pain of memory. The disappearance of a son in a small village—and the secret it both creates and harbors—forms the framework of the play. One must move beyond this to discover the difficulty everyone faces in getting along with others, the impossibility of a peaceful relationship with the world, and the triumph of silence. This is not a story about the revelation of a secret, but about village rumors—and, at its heart, the difficulty of caring for one’s own. Failure lies at the center of everything—the world and the self. Everything is an acknowledgment of failure. Boronat writes about this failure, but he offers no resolution beyond poetic echoes that allow future audiences and readers to glimpse the impossible interplay of the worlds that constitute us, both socially and within ourselves.
